Every other skill in this plugin acts on the work in flight. This one acts on completed work. After a PR merges and CI is green, this skill produces a short retrospective: which adversarial-review findings turned out to matter, which gates produced false positives, which skill activations didn't fire when they should have. The output sits in docs/retros/ and feeds back into the next iteration of the plugin itself.
Core principle: the only way the gates get sharper is if completed work is read back against the predictions they made. This skill does the reading.

If the PR was opened ad-hoc (no design / plan in docs/plans/), this skill exits cleanly without writing a retro — there's nothing to compare against.

Score each code-review comment.
For every code-review comment that requested a change, ask: which gate, if any, should have caught this earlier? Map the comment to the most-upstream gate that could have caught it (brainstorming self-challenge / adversarial-design-review design / adversarial-design-review plan / alignment-check / requesting-code-review / none). Comments mapped to a gate that was supposed to catch them but didn't are gate misses — the most actionable retro signal.
Score CI failure history.
For each unique CI failure on the branch, ask: was this caught by verification-before-completion / runtime-launch-validation / something else, or did it slip past every local gate? Slips are gate misses too.

Verify the expected pipeline ran. The canonical chain documented in skills/using-autodev/SKILL.md is:
brainstorming → adversarial-design-review (design) → writing-plans → adversarial-design-review (plan) → alignment-check → subagent-driven-development → finishing-a-development-branch → pr-monitoring → post-merge-retrospective.
For each gate that was expected to fire and didn't, that's a missed-activation.
When the merged PR's diff touched docs/examples, record finishing Step 1e as fired iff a Doc-reconciliation: line is present in the PR body, else unverified. If the diff touched no docs/examples, record no row (Step 1e legitimately did not fire).
Backfeed project design guidance.
Invoke autodev:project-design-guidance. If the merged work reveals a
durable cross-design lesson, update docs/design-guidance.md in the same
commit as the retro. Durable lessons include language/runtime/framework
direction changes, new product/application modes, deployment/compliance/
privacy/operations constraints, repeated gate misses that should become a
design principle, or false assumptions in existing guidance. Do not append
one-off implementation trivia.

This is short, structured analysis work — one pass over the artifacts. Run inline, not as a subagent. The lead agent has the context already. If the artifact set is large (10+ code-review threads, dozens of CI runs), dispatch a balanced-tier general-purpose subagent with the artifact paths inline.
<host: codex, opencode, cursor> Run inline. The lead agent has the context already. The retro is a structured artifact, not a long-running task — produce the markdown directly.
pr-monitoring exits when CI is green and reviews are resolved. That's the end of the in-flight pipeline, but it's not the end of the loop. Without post-merge-retrospective, the plugin has no organic way to know which gates are actually pulling their weight. With it, every merged PR produces a small piece of evidence that gets compared across PRs over time. That's how the gate set sharpens.
The retro is intentionally short. Long retros don't get read. The format above fits on one screen for a typical PR; the gate-miss table is the only required-non-empty section if there's anything to learn.
